The Punisher was Marvel and Capcom's first collaboration, and it brought a grittier edge to the already-violent beat-em-up genre upon its release in 1993. The game features the standard Punisher storyline (Frank Castle's family is gunned down, and he seeks revenge against the Kingpin), with Castle teaming up with Nick Fury (back when he was a cigar-chomping white guy) to take down hordes of bad guys. Appropriately, this involves a lot more guns and hand grenades than your typical beat-em-up game, diffused somewhat by comics-inspired BLAM! and KRAK! effects. Though it lacks the range of recognizable characters of Konami's 1992 X-Men beat-em-up, The Punisher features sophisticated graphics for its time and action that should satisfy beat-em-up fans.
